UnCaged Studios Raises $24M to Support Web3 Game Developers
The company will use the funds to build out its Solana-based esports franchise MonkeyLeague ahead of its public launch.

Web3 gaming company UnCaged Studios has raised $24 million in a Series A equity funding round, with participation from Griffin Gaming Partners, Vgames, Maverick Ventures Israel, Drive by DraftKings and 6th Man Ventures, according to a press release Thursday.
The company is now valued at over $150 million, according to an UnCaged spokesperson.
UnCaged will use the funding to develop its Solana-based esports franchise MonkeyLeague ahead of its public launch at the end of the year. Prior to the current funding round, MonkeyLeague had a $4 million token presale.
The money will also be used for future projects on its native Game OS platform. Game OS supports those entering blockchain gaming through its end-to-end developer platform. From tokenomics to non-fungible token (NFT) integration, it is intended to help gaming companies make the switch from Web2 to Web3.
UnCaged isn’t alone in its efforts to support blockchain game developers. Last week, Web3 gaming network Planetarium Labs raised $32 million in a Series A round led by Animoca Brands. And in March, gaming development platform Joyride raised $14 million in seed funding.
UnCaged was founded in 2021 by Raz and Tal Friedman, brothers who previously worked at Israeli gaming company Playtika.

Pudgy Penguins: A New Blueprint for Tokenized Culture

Pudgy Penguins is building a multi-vertical consumer IP platform — combining phygital products, games, NFTs and PENGU to monetize culture at scale.
What to know:
Pudgy Penguins is emerging as one of the strongest NFT-native brands of this cycle, shifting from speculative “digital luxury goods” into a multi-vertical consumer IP platform. Its strategy is to acquire users through mainstream channels first; toys, retail partnerships and viral media, then onboard them into Web3 through games, NFTs and the PENGU token.
The ecosystem now spans phygital products (> $13M retail sales and >1M units sold), games and experiences (Pudgy Party surpassed 500k downloads in two weeks), and a widely distributed token (airdropped to 6M+ wallets). While the market is currently pricing Pudgy at a premium relative to traditional IP peers, sustained success depends on execution across retail expansion, gaming adoption and deeper token utility.

World token jumps 27% as Sam Altman reportedly eyes a biometric social network to kill off bots

The WLD token surged after Forbes reported that Sam Altman's OpenAI is planning to use Worldcoin to fight bots online.
What to know:
- World’s WLD token jumped sharply on Wednesday after a Forbes report said Sam Altman’s OpenAI is exploring a biometric social network to combat online bots.
- The report said OpenAI has considered using Apple’s Face ID or World’s iris-scanning Orb device to verify human users, though no formal partnership between OpenAI and World has been confirmed.
- World Network, which has raised $135 million and says it has verified millions of people, is pitching its World ID system as a privacy-focused way to prove personhood online even as it faces regulatory scrutiny in countries such as Kenya and the U.K.
